Yuki Takei 7 лет назад
Родитель
Сommit
be2838fa75
2 измененных файлов с 31 добавлено и 33 удалено
  1. 1 1
      lib/locales/en-US/translation.json
  2. 30 32
      lib/views/admin/widget/passport/ldap.html

+ 1 - 1
lib/locales/en-US/translation.json

@@ -363,7 +363,7 @@
       "search_filter_example2": "Match with 'sAMAccountName' for Active Directory",
       "username_detail": "Specification of mappings for <code>username</code> when creating new users",
       "name_detail": "Specification of mappings for full name when creating new users",
-      "email_detail": "Specification of mappings for mail address when creating new users",
+      "mail_detail": "Specification of mappings for mail address when creating new users",
       "group_search_base_DN": "Group Search Base DN",
       "group_search_base_DN_detail": "The base DN from which to search for groups. If defined, also <code>Group Search Filter</code> must be defined for the search to work.",
       "group_search_filter": "Group Search Filter",

+ 30 - 32
lib/views/admin/widget/passport/ldap.html

@@ -120,58 +120,56 @@
       <h4>Attribute Mapping ({{ t("security_setting.optional") }})</h4>
 
       <div class="form-group">
-        <div class="row">
-          <label for="settingForm[security:passport-ldap:attrMapUsername]" class="col-xs-3 control-label">username</label>
-          <div class="col-xs-6">
-            <input class="form-control" type="text" placeholder="Default: uid"
-                name="settingForm[security:passport-ldap:attrMapUsername]" value="{{ settingForm['security:passport-ldap:attrMapUsername'] || '' }}">
+        <label for="settingForm[security:passport-ldap:attrMapUsername]" class="col-xs-3 control-label">username</label>
+        <div class="col-xs-6">
+          <input class="form-control" type="text" placeholder="Default: uid"
+              name="settingForm[security:passport-ldap:attrMapUsername]" value="{{ settingForm['security:passport-ldap:attrMapUsername'] || '' }}">
+          <p class="help-block">
+            <small>
+              {{ t("security_setting.ldap.username_detail") }}
+            </small>
+          </p>
+        </div>
+      </div>
+
+      <div class="form-group">
+        <div class="col-xs-6 col-xs-offset-3">
+          <div class="checkbox checkbox-info">
+            <input type="checkbox" id="cbSameUsernameTreatedAsIdenticalUser" name="settingForm[security:passport-ldap:isSameUsernameTreatedAsIdenticalUser]" value="1"
+                {% if settingForm['security:passport-ldap:isSameUsernameTreatedAsIdenticalUser'] %}checked{% endif %} />
+            <label for="cbSameUsernameTreatedAsIdenticalUser">
+              {{ t("security_setting.Treat username matching as identical", "username") }}
+            </label>
             <p class="help-block">
               <small>
-                {{ t("security_setting.ldap.username_detail") }}
+                {{ t("security_setting.Treat username matching as identical_warn", "username") }}
               </small>
             </p>
           </div>
         </div>
-
-        <div class="row">
-          <div class="col-xs-6 col-xs-offset-3">
-            <div class="checkbox checkbox-info">
-              <input type="checkbox" id="cbSameUsernameTreatedAsIdenticalUser" name="settingForm[security:passport-ldap:isSameUsernameTreatedAsIdenticalUser]" value="1"
-                  {% if settingForm['security:passport-ldap:isSameUsernameTreatedAsIdenticalUser'] %}checked{% endif %} />
-              <label for="cbSameUsernameTreatedAsIdenticalUser">
-                {{ t("security_setting.Treat username matching as identical", "username") }}
-              </label>
-              <p class="help-block">
-                <small>
-                  {{ t("security_setting.Treat username matching as identical_warn", "username") }}
-                </small>
-              </p>
-            </div>
-          </div>
-        </div>
       </div>
 
-      <div class="row">
-        <label for="settingForm[security:passport-ldap:attrMapName]" class="col-xs-3 control-label">Name</label>
+      <div class="form-group">
+        <label for="settingForm[security:passport-ldap:attrMapMail]" class="col-xs-3 control-label">Mail</label>
         <div class="col-xs-6">
-          <input class="form-control" type="text"
-              name="settingForm[security:passport-ldap:attrMapName]" value="{{ settingForm['security:passport-ldap:attrMapName'] || '' }}">
+          <input class="form-control" type="text" placeholder="Default: mail"
+              name="settingForm[security:passport-ldap:attrMapMail]" value="{{ settingForm['security:passport-ldap:attrMapMail'] || '' }}">
           <p class="help-block">
             <small>
-              {{ t("security_setting.ldap.name_detail") }}
+              {{ t("security_setting.ldap.mail_detail") }}
             </small>
           </p>
         </div>
       </div>
 
-      <div class="row">
-        <label for="settingForm[security:passport-ldap:attrMapMail]" class="col-xs-3 control-label">Mail</label>
+      <div class="form-group">
+        <label for="settingForm[security:passport-ldap:attrMapName]" class="col-xs-3 control-label">Name</label>
         <div class="col-xs-6">
           <input class="form-control" type="text"
-              name="settingForm[security:passport-ldap:attrMapMail]" value="{{ settingForm['security:passport-ldap:attrMapMail'] || '' }}">
+              name="settingForm[security:passport-ldap:attrMapName]" value="{{ settingForm['security:passport-ldap:attrMapName'] || '' }}">
           <p class="help-block">
             <small>
-              {{ t("security_setting.ldap.mail_detail") }}
+              {{ t("security_setting.ldap.name_detail") }}
             </small>
           </p>
         </div>